Israeli Army Fires Live Ammunition at Gaza Demonstrators

Palestine News & Info Agency - WAFA - Israeli Army Fires Live Ammunition at Gaza Demonstrators:

GAZA, January 24, 2012 (WAFA) – Israeli soldiers fired live ammunition and tear gas on Tuesday at a peaceful demonstration near the northern Gaza borders with Israel, according to a statement by the International Solidarity Movement.

It said around 50 rounds of live ammunition were fired directly at the Palestinian and international demonstrators who were protesting Israel’s ban on Palestinians from reaching their land hundreds of meters within the vicinity of the borders.

“From approximately a 25 meter distance, live ammunition was fired by Israeli military from watch towers, along with a few rounds of gas canisters also directly targeting demonstrators,” said the statement. No one was injured.
